Kilburn stabbing: Boy, 15, rushed to hospital and arrested after being wounded near busy high street

A teenage boy has been rushed to hospital after being stabbed near a busy high street in north London.

The 15-year-old was later arrested for possession of an offensive weapon following the attack in Kilburn, Brent.

Metropolitan Police officers and London Ambulance Service paramedics attended Brondesbury Villas near Kilburn High Road and found the boy wounded.

He was taken to hospital for further treatment where his injuries were found not to be life-changing or life-threatening.

In a statement, Scotland Yard said their enquiries into the incident at around 5.15pm on Tuesday are ongoing.

A spokesman for the force said: "If you have any information that could help police please contact 101 quoting CAD5753/07OCT.”

The LAS said: “We were called at 5.17pm on Tuesday, October 7 to reports of a stabbing in Brondesbury Villas, NW6.

“We sent resources including ambulance crews, paramedics in response cars and an incident response officer. We treated a teenager at the scene and took him to a London major trauma centre.”
